The limitations of cryptographic agility in Bitcoin

Feb 13 - Feb 26, 2026

  • The discussions on the Bitcoin Development Mailing List have delved into the complexities of incorporating cryptographic agility and post-quantum cryptography within the Bitcoin ecosystem.

The discourse centers around the theoretical and practical implications of integrating new digital signature algorithms, such as a hypothetical "FancySig," alongside or in replacement of Bitcoin's current secp256k1 algorithm. This conversation arises from concerns over potential vulnerabilities to quantum computing and the desire for a more secure cryptographic future for Bitcoin.

One significant point of contention is the idea of allowing users and wallets to choose their cryptographic primitives, which raises concerns about the collective security and fungibility of Bitcoin. The principle of fungibility suggests that the value and security of Bitcoin are not merely determined by individual choices but are intrinsically linked to the community's collective decisions. The introduction of FancySig serves to illustrate the potential division within the community between those advocating for rapid adoption due to security fears and those urging caution given the untested nature of new cryptographic schemes.

Further, the discussion explores the broader ramifications of adopting new cryptographic standards. It highlights the need for a collective shift in the Bitcoin ecosystem's underlying security assumptions. Rather than an "either/or" situation with secp256k1 and a new scheme, there would be a need for an "and" scenario, where the security of both the old and new cryptographic methods would be imperative. This shift underscores the complexity of integrating new cryptographic primitives into established systems like Bitcoin.

Additionally, practical considerations regarding the disabling of elliptic curve (EC) operations are discussed in the context of future developments that might render them insecure. The potential necessity of such a drastic measure raises questions about the viability of chains that persist with known vulnerabilities, suggesting they could lose their value.

The dialogue also touches on the historical precedents of Bitcoin's protocol evolution, such as instances where previously valid redeem scripts have been invalidated through soft forks. This history contradicts assertions that significant changes to the protocol, including those addressing vulnerabilities, would lead to Bitcoin's destruction. Instead, it points to the nuanced possibilities for evolving Bitcoin's protocol in response to emerging threats while maintaining its foundational principles.

Moreover, the importance of carefully considering soft and hard forks' technical and social ramifications is underscored, particularly regarding users' confidence and the perception of Bitcoin's security. Historical examples demonstrate a cautious approach to protocol development aimed at preserving Bitcoin's integrity and the trust of its user base.

In sum, these discussions encapsulate the complex balance between innovation, security, and stability within the cryptocurrency realm. They highlight the critical role of consensus in navigating the path toward securing Bitcoin against both theoretical and practical cryptographic threats while upholding its core values and operational principles.

Link to Raw Post
Bitcoin Logo

TLDR

Join Our Newsletter

We’ll email you summaries of the latest discussions from high signal bitcoin sources, like bitcoin-dev, lightning-dev, and Delving Bitcoin.

Explore all Products

ChatBTC imageBitcoin searchBitcoin TranscriptsSaving SatoshiDecoding BitcoinWarnet
Built with 🧡 by the Bitcoin Dev Project
View our public visitor count

We'd love to hear your feedback on this project.

Give Feedback